Best value for us is definitely lunch at Villa de Flora. This is a high quality buffet where we can easily eat 6 or 7 quality courses for $19.99 per head adult, including soft drinks.
We don't eat anything else much that day and can barely walk as we always over induldge as the food is so tasty. No two days are the same at the atmosphere is like being sat outside a cafe in the mediteranean. It is covered by a huge glass dome, so feels like you are outside, even though you are in an air conditioned space - bit like the dome at Center Parcs if you have ever been , but much much much bigger. Located just off the I4/192/International Drive South.
If you are ever in Orlando for Christmas , it is great for Christmas lunch too.
